Preventing Fine Lines and Wrinkles

There’s a cliché that gets bandied about quite a bit when it comes to fighting fine lines, wrinkles, and other signs of premature aging.

The best anti-aging treatment is prevention.

But clichés are often clichés for a reason – because they’re true.

Whether you’re in your twenties or early thirties, it’s never too early to start fighting the visible signs of aging. In fact, the earlier you start a good, targeted skin care regime, the longer you can put off those pesky little fine lines that give away your age just as readily as your driver’s license.

You’ve probably heard it before, but it bears repeating – the most effective anti-aging product on the market is a good sunscreen. Ultraviolet (UV) rays from the sun break down elastin, which are fibers in the skin that help it retain its shape. With prolonged exposure to the sun, your skin can begin to stretch and sag, without the ability to snap back into place. Sun damage also leaves your skin more prone to brusing, tearing, and wrinkling.

Using a broad spectrum sunscreen every day can protect your skin from aging UV rays. After sunscreen, the best anti-aging treatment that you can introduce to your skin care regime in your twenties and thirties is retinol. Retinol helps stimulate collagen and elastin production deep within in the skin to make it look firmer and smoother, but it also helps remove dead, dull cells on the surface of the skin and encourage new cell growth to help keep your complexion smooth and glowing.

Retinol can be pretty irritating, though – redness, flaking and itchiness are all common side effects, so it’s not a good option if you have sensitive skin. Even if your skin isn’t sensitive, you should introduce it into your regime slowly. Use retinol products only in the evening, too, since it makes your skin more sensitive to sun damage. The final step to take in your twenties and thirties to avoid fine lines and wrinkles is to use an eye cream regularly. The skin around the eyes is extremely thin and delicate, so it’s usually the first area where fine lines and wrinkles pop up. Using an effective, moisturizing eye cream can help keep the area hydrated so fine lines are less likely to occur.

For a really potent option, though, try a moisturizing cream that also contains alpha hydroxy acid to help exfoliate dead skin cells so your under eye area stays smooth and line-free.
